Understanding the Basics of Online Betting

Online betting revolves around placing wagers on various events or games through digital platforms. At its core, effective gambling requires a solid understanding of key concepts such as odds, house edge, and return-to-player (RTP) percentages. The house edge represents the casino's advantage over players, which can vary across games. For instance, games like blackjack and baccarat have a lower house edge compared to slot machines.

To maximize potential payouts, players need to familiarize themselves with odds calculations. Understanding the difference between fractional odds, decimal odds, and moneyline odds can significantly enhance a player’s decision-making process. Moreover, calculating expected value (EV) helps players determine whether a bet is worth taking based on statistical probabilities and outcomes.

Bankroll Management Best Practices

Bankroll management underpins successful gambling practices. Players should establish clear budgets, setting aside only what they can afford to lose. Key techniques include setting loss limits to protect against excessive losses and session planning to maintain a disciplined approach.

Moreover, employing a systematic betting strategy, such as the stake percentage method (betting a small percentage of your total bankroll on each wager), can help stretch a bankroll over a longer period. This practice not only minimizes risk but also extends the playing experience, allowing for better decision-making during critical moments.

Understanding Gambling Behavior

Various factors contribute to an individual's gambling behavior, including cognitive biases such as the illusion of control, where players believe they can influence random outcomes. Awareness of these biases can help players make more informed decisions and reduce impulsive betting behaviors.

Additionally, the social environment surrounding gambling can heavily influence a player’s approach. Players often make different decisions when engaged in social settings compared to when they gamble alone. Being mindful of such factors can empower players to maintain better control over their gambling habits.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id

There are numerous pitfalls in gambling that can lead to unfavorable outcomes. One of the most common mistakes is chasing losses, which can escalate into significant financial trouble. Establishing clear limits and adhering to them is critical in preventing this behavior.

Other pitfalls include not understanding the rules of the games thoroughly or failing to research strategies before committing funds. Regularly educating oneself on game mechanics can bolster confidence and enhance decision-making.

Blockchain and Cryptocurrency in Gambling

The emergence of blockchain technology and cryptocurrency within the gambling sector heralds a new era of transparency and security. Cryptocurrency transactions allow for faster deposits and withdrawals, often with lower fees compared to traditional banking methods.

Additionally, blockchain technology can facilitate provably fair gaming, where players can verify game outcomes independently, thereby building trust in online gaming platforms.
